Overview
- Running dishwashers, washing machines, or tumble dryers overnight or unattended increases fire risks due to high wattage and mechanical stress, warns Staffordshire Fire and Rescue Service.
- The fire service highlights a misconception, fueled by social media, that using electricity at night is cheaper, noting that most UK households are not on off-peak tariffs like Economy 7.
- Fires at night pose a greater risk to life as residents are likely asleep, reducing reaction time for escape.
- Community Safety Officer Hannah Grostate advises checking appliances for recalls, damaged cables, and ensuring they are in good working order to mitigate fire hazards.
- Residents are urged to maintain working smoke alarms on every floor and establish clear exit plans for emergencies to enhance home safety.
